From dfc716267507518bca220b44794529380b28d2f2 Mon Sep 17 00:00:00 2001 From: Michael Hoennig Date: Thu, 11 Aug 2022 12:43:29 +0200 Subject: [PATCH] fix references in api-definition --- src/main/resources/api-definition/hs-customers.yaml | 2 +- .../resources/api-definition/hs-package-schemas.yaml | 2 +- .../resources/api-definition/hs-packages-uuid.yaml | 12 ++++++------ src/main/resources/api-definition/hs-packages.yaml | 10 +++++----- 4 files changed, 13 insertions(+), 13 deletions(-) diff --git a/src/main/resources/api-definition/hs-customers.yaml b/src/main/resources/api-definition/hs-customers.yaml index d57022b0..8092b04c 100644 --- a/src/main/resources/api-definition/hs-customers.yaml +++ b/src/main/resources/api-definition/hs-customers.yaml @@ -47,7 +47,7 @@ post: content: 'application/json': schema: - $ref: './api-definition/hs-customer-schemas/components.yaml#/schemas/Customer' + $ref: './api-definition/hs-customer-schemas.yaml#/components/schemas/Customer' "401": $ref: './api-definition/error-responses.yaml#/components/responses/Unauthorized' "403": diff --git a/src/main/resources/api-definition/hs-package-schemas.yaml b/src/main/resources/api-definition/hs-package-schemas.yaml index 201e518e..92b0c4ed 100644 --- a/src/main/resources/api-definition/hs-package-schemas.yaml +++ b/src/main/resources/api-definition/hs-package-schemas.yaml @@ -10,7 +10,7 @@ components: type: string format: uuid customer: - $ref: './api-definition/hs-customers-schemas.yaml#/components/schemas/Customer' + $ref: './api-definition/hs-customer-schemas.yaml#/components/schemas/Customer' name: type: string description: diff --git a/src/main/resources/api-definition/hs-packages-uuid.yaml b/src/main/resources/api-definition/hs-packages-uuid.yaml index 864e816a..269a9e45 100644 --- a/src/main/resources/api-definition/hs-packages-uuid.yaml +++ b/src/main/resources/api-definition/hs-packages-uuid.yaml @@ -3,8 +3,8 @@ patch: - packages operationId: updatePackage parameters: - - $ref: '#/components/parameters/currentUser' - - $ref: '#/components/parameters/assumedRoles' + - $ref: './api-definition/auth.yaml#/components/parameters/currentUser' + - $ref: './api-definition/auth.yaml#/components/parameters/assumedRoles' - name: packageUUID in: path required: true @@ -15,15 +15,15 @@ patch: content: 'application/json': schema: - $ref: '#/components/schemas/PackageUpdate' + $ref: './api-definition/hs-package-schemas.yaml#/components/schemas/PackageUpdate' responses: "200": description: OK content: 'application/json': schema: - $ref: '#/components/schemas/Package' + $ref: './api-definition/hs-package-schemas.yaml#/components/schemas/Package' "401": - $ref: '#/components/responses/Unauthorized' + $ref: './api-definition/error-responses.yaml#/components/responses/Unauthorized' "403": - $ref: '#/components/responses/Forbidden' + $ref: './api-definition/error-responses.yaml#/components/responses/Forbidden' diff --git a/src/main/resources/api-definition/hs-packages.yaml b/src/main/resources/api-definition/hs-packages.yaml index 705af1b1..1888ceb2 100644 --- a/src/main/resources/api-definition/hs-packages.yaml +++ b/src/main/resources/api-definition/hs-packages.yaml @@ -3,8 +3,8 @@ get: - packages operationId: listPackages parameters: - - $ref: './auth.yaml#/components/parameters/currentUser' - - $ref: './auth.yaml#/components/parameters/assumedRoles' + - $ref: './api-definition/auth.yaml#/components/parameters/currentUser' + - $ref: './api-definition/auth.yaml#/components/parameters/assumedRoles' - name: name in: query required: false @@ -18,8 +18,8 @@ get: schema: type: array items: - $ref: './hs-package-schemas/components/schemas/Package' + $ref: './api-definition/hs-package-schemas.yaml#/components/schemas/Package' "401": - $ref: './error-responses.yaml#/components/responses/Unauthorized' + $ref: './api-definition/error-responses.yaml#/components/responses/Unauthorized' "403": - $ref: './error-responses.yaml#/components/responses/Forbidden' + $ref: './api-definition/error-responses.yaml#/components/responses/Forbidden'